I found a neat free program call "USB disk ejector." It allows you to bypass 
the "Safe to remove hardware" by actually naming the USB device rather than 
calling the device "master storage device" or something similar. If you have 
two devices plugged in windows will often call both devices "master storage 
device" which means you might eject the wrong device incorrectly. 
Unfortunately, (at least for me) the program requires the use of the jaws 
cursor a lot. But I bet (smile) somebody could write a script that would more 
easily show the list of devices plugged in to the PC. For more information see 
the link below.
